Juneteenth celebrations around Georgetown
Kaitlyn Wilkes
A Georgetown tradition for 72 years, the city’s Juneteenth celebration will take place over two days on June 14-15. Juneteenth marks the day that slaves were freed in Texas.

Taste of the town: Matzo for Passover
Linda Dwyer
Mazel tov! Passover 2024 began at sundown on April 22 and ends after nightfall on April 30. The weeklong spring festival of Passover commemorates suffering and celebrates liberation.

2024 Texas Bach Festival moving to First United Methodist Church
Katherine Hamilton
The Texas Bach Festival — on its way to becoming a Georgetown musical institution — will settle into a new home in its 2024 season, First United Methodist Church.
This year is also FUMC’s 175th anniversary in Georgetown.
